Accounting & Asset Manager Brooklyn NY $100000$150000
About the Role A growing real estate development company is looking for a detail-oriented Accounting and Asset Manager to oversee day-to-day accounting operations and asset-level financial management across a portfolio of multifamily and mixed-use development projects. This role combines hands-on accounting responsibilities with proactive asset oversight ensuring project and property financials are accurate transparent and timely. The ideal candidate is organized collaborative and eager to grow alongside a fast-moving development company.
Key Responsibilities
Accounting & Financial Operations
- Manage day-to-day accounting functions including accounts payable receivable and general ledger maintenance
- Utilize job-cost accounting to track hard and soft costs loan draws and vendor payments for active projects
- Prepare monthly and quarterly financial statements project cost reports and supporting schedules
- Prepare and manage monthly lender draw packages including requisition forms backup documentation and lien waivers
- Reconcile bank accounts review vendor invoices and coordinate subcontractor payments and approvals
Asset Management & Portfolio Oversight
- Monitor property and project performance including budget vs. actual analysis cash flow forecasting and return tracking
- Track operating metrics such as occupancy rent collections and expense ratios once assets stabilize
- Collaborate with property managers and ownership to prepare annual budgets and variance analyses
- Support refinancing leasing and disposition analysis with updated pro formas and financial summaries
Lender Investor & Reporting
- Coordinate with lenders and equity partners to ensure timely and compliant funding and reporting
- Prepare asset-level reports and quarterly investor updates for internal management and external partners
- Consolidate project-level data into portfolio dashboards and assist with underwriting new opportunities
Qualifications
- Bachelors degree in Accounting Finance or related field; CPA or CPA track preferred
- 36 years of experience in accounting or finance ideally within real estate development construction or property management
- Familiarity with draw processes cost-to-complete forecasting and partnership accounting
- Proficiency in QuickBooks and Excel; experience with Yardi Procore or Sage Intacct a plus
- Highly organized process-oriented and able to thrive in a fast-paced entrepreneurial environment
